About eflornithine
Tipo di medicinale | A skin cream to reduce hair growth |
Utilizzato per | Reducing unwanted facial hair for women (if caused by a medical condition or treatment) |
Chiamato anche | Vaniqa® |
Disponibile come | Cream |
Some hormonal disorders in women can lead to the growth of thick or dark facial hair, called hirsutism. Hirsutism can also be a side-effect of taking some medicines. It occurs either as a result of an increased production of an androgenic hormone (such as the male sex hormone testosterone), or because the skin has become more sensitive to this type of hormone.
When applied to the skin, eflornithine works by blocking the action of an enzyme in hair follicles which is involved in the production of hair. It can be used alongside laser therapy, to help reduce the rate at which unwanted facial hair grows in women who have this problem.

How to use eflornithine cream
Torna ai contenutiBefore you start the treatment, read the manufacturer's printed information leaflet from inside the pack. It will give you more information about eflornithine cream and will provide you with a full list of the side-effects which you may experience from using it.
If you have just used a hair remover or shaved, leave at least five minutes before you apply eflornithine cream. This will help to reduce any stinging or burning, which could otherwise occur.
Apply eflornithine cream twice a day to the areas of your face or chin which are affected. You should leave at least eight hours between the two applications. You only need to apply a thin layer of cream and you should rub it in well (until you can no longer see any cream on your face). Try not to get any cream in or near your eyes or mouth, as it may cause irritation.
After applying the cream, you should wash your hands to remove any cream left on your fingers but, if possible, do not wash your face during the following four hours.
Ottenere il massimo dal tuo trattamento
Torna ai contenutiEflornithine cream is not a depilatory cream. You may need to continue with your usual hair removal routines. Ways to remove unwanted hair include shaving, plucking, waxing, hair-removing creams, electrolysis, and laser treatments. Your doctor will advise you about which of these are suitable for you to use alongside eflornithine cream.
If you want to apply make-up to the areas of skin that you've applied the cream to, you can do this, but please wait for at least five minutes after applying eflornithine cream before you do so.
It is important that you use the cream regularly. It can take about eight weeks before you start to see the full benefit from using it. If after four months of using the cream there is little improvement, please discuss this with your doctor who will review your treatment.
Eflornithine cream is not intended for use by men, or by girls under 18 years old.

Can eflornithine cream cause problems?
Torna ai contenutiAlong with their useful effects, medicated skin creams can cause unwanted side-effects although not everyone experiences them. The table below contains some of the most common ones associated with eflornithine cream. You will find a full list in the manufacturer's information leaflet supplied with the cream. The unwanted effects often improve as your body adjusts to the new medicine, but speak with your doctor or pharmacist if any of the following continue or become troublesome.
Very common eflornithine side-effects (these affect more than 1 in 10 women) | Cosa posso fare se sperimento questo? |
Acne | Se problematico, parla con il tuo medico |
Common eflornithine side-effects (these affect fewer than 1 in 10 women) | Cosa posso fare se sperimento questo? |
Skin irritation, itching, dryness, redness | Try applying the cream just once a day for a few days to allow your skin to recover. If the irritation continues, speak with your doctor for further advice |
If you experience any other symptoms which you think may be due to the cream, speak with your doctor or pharmacist for further advice.
How to store eflornithine cream
Torna ai contenutiTenere tutti i medicinali fuori dalla portata e dalla vista dei bambini.
Conservare in un luogo fresco e asciutto, lontano da fonti di calore e luce diretta.
Any unused cream should be discarded six months after opening. It may be helpful to write the date you opened the cream on to the pharmacy label.
